Neighborhood Overview
Fortin Park is situated on the western edge of Oneonta, New York, a city nestled in the Susquehanna River valley. Its location provides a convenient access point for regional visitors traveling via major routes. The park is primarily accessed from Youngs Road, which connects to State Route 7 (Susquehanna Expressway), a principal north-south artery in the region. For those flying in, the nearest significant airport is Albany International Airport (ALB), approximately a 75-mile drive northeast. Binghamton Broome County Airport (BGM) is another option, about 60 miles to the southwest. Driving times can vary significantly based on traffic, especially during peak commuting hours or if approaching from different directions along Route 7. Public transit options within Oneonta are limited, making personal vehicles or rideshares the most practical modes of transport for reaching the park. Smart arrival tactics involve checking local traffic reports before heading out, particularly on tournament days, and allowing extra time to find parking and navigate to your designated field or facility.
Where to Stay
Within Oneonta, lodging options are concentrated primarily along the main commercial corridors and near the downtown area, generally within a 5-10 minute drive of Fortin Park. While there aren't hotels immediately adjacent to the park itself, several chain hotels and local motels are available. For teams and families looking for accommodations, areas around Main Street and the Route 8 corridor offer the most variety. It’s common for visiting groups to book blocks of rooms in these central locations. Booking well in advance is highly recommended, especially during spring and summer when the park hosts numerous tournaments and youth sports events, leading to high demand for local hotels. Utilizing map filters for hotels within a 5-mile radius of the park can help narrow down choices, and direct inquiries with hotels about team rates are often beneficial.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Oneonta is cold with temperatures often below freezing, frequently accompanied by snow and ice. Outdoor sports at Fortin Park are generally not feasible during this season. Visitors traveling for indoor events or brief excursions should pack heavy winter coats, hats, gloves, and waterproof boots. Driving conditions can be challenging, so checking weather and road reports is crucial.
Spring & early summer
Spring weather can be variable, with mild days interspersed with cooler temperatures and rain. Early summer remains mild, gradually warming into comfortable conditions for outdoor sports. Light jackets or sweatshirts are advisable for cooler mornings and evenings. Expect occasional rain, so packing ponchos or umbrellas is a good idea for game days.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er typically brings warm to hot temperatures, with averages often in the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it. Sunny days are common, making hydration and sun protection paramount for players and spectators. Light, breathable clothing is recommended. Bring sunscreen, hats, and sunglasses for protection during extended periods outdoors.
Fall season
Fall offers crisp, cool air, with temperatures gradually decreasing throughout the season. Mornings and evenings can be quite chilly, while afternoons may remain pleasantly mild. Layering clothing is the best strategy, including sweaters or light jackets. The foliage provides beautiful scenery, but be prepared for cooler, potentially damp conditions as the season progresses.
Rain & snow
Rain is common in spring and fall and can occur during summer. Visitors should always be prepared for precipitation by packing rain gear. Snowfall is characteristic of winter. Unexpected weather changes can happen year-round, so checking the forecast before and during your visit is highly recommended to adjust plans and packing accordingly.
